5-7-Reversal Proves correct

I wrote in this morning comments that when a stock as 5 to 7 consecutive red days (or green for that matter), one is to expect a reversal. I had a trend line alert set in QuoteTracker and when it crossed, that would be my signal to buy...




  • iSign Media Solutions Inc. (TSX-V: ISD) Got the alert at $0.34 and bough into it. Just closed position on it as I think we'll see a bit of a pull now. 5-7-Reversal proved to be correct than provided 14.7% gains.

A different view now...



  • Focus Metals Inc. (TSX-V: FMS) Always good to have a second view on a chart as I was just reminded by George of Agoracom via Twitter... Thanks George! The last time I talked about Focus Metals it had formed a Bull Flag and had just broken out of the flag portion. The calculated move on the Bull Flag was well over $2.00 but it never got there, decrease chart pattern success rate by one! LOL! Its been drifting down for a while and perhaps it has formed another pattern, which is what I should have done a while ago on it...

    As it turns out, we could be seeing a Falling Wedge now except that is has not bounced on the lower trend line as often as 'suggested' by the chart pattern. I should have at least 5 bounces (from top to bottom) to really validate the formation. But with the 200SMA trend line not too far below and today's move up from the lower trend line, it could be the start of a move up. So what will convince me? Indicators (both the Slow Stochastic and Relative Strength Index) are still in the oversold area, not good and no clear entry point. So I'm going to wait for the indicators to turn upwards and the price to move above the upper trend line with an increase of volume.
